Transaction

8623e1f20db996dc1497224e107542e2d04bfa1d6181fe4a20e10965abda5b27
219,923 confirmations
Timestamp
1641920217
Block718,173
Fee950 sats
Fee rate4.95 sats/vB
view on mempool.space

Inputs & Outputs